    <title>ITAT prevents double taxation of unbilled revenue erroneously offered twice by appellant across assessment years</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/highlights?id=89605</link>
    <description>ITAT allowed appellant&#039;s appeal regarding double taxation of unbilled revenue. Appellant erroneously offered excess income to tax by accruing unbilled revenue from one customer, which was subsequently taxed again in AY 2019-20 upon invoice generation. Tribunal examined computation statements and revised returns, confirming revenue reduction in FY 2019-20 was added back in AY 2020-21 computation. ITAT found merit in appellant&#039;s contention that income was taxed twice - initially as unbilled revenue in respective financial years and again upon invoice raising in the assessment year under consideration. Tribunal directed Assessing Officer to reduce appellant&#039;s income by the amount erroneously excess offered to tax, preventing double taxation of the same revenue stream.</description>
